Test leads are essential tools used in laboratory settings to connect test equipment, such as multimeters and oscilloscopes, to devices under test. They come in various configurations and materials, each designed for specific applications.
Where To Use Test Leads
Test leads are widely used in various industries, including electronics, automotive, and aerospace. They can be found in laboratories, workshops, and on assembly lines where testing and measurement are required.

How To Use Test Leads
Connect the test lead to the test equipment (e.g., multimeter)
Connect the other end of the test lead to the device under test
Ensure proper connection and secure the leads in place
Take accurate readings using the connected test equipment
